Calculating the Time Difference: The Nitty-Gritty
Alright, let's get down to the actual calculation of the Los Angeles to Philippines time difference. It's not rocket science, but it does require paying attention to daylight saving time. As mentioned earlier, the Philippines does not observe daylight saving time, so it's a constant UTC+8. Los Angeles, on the other hand, does. So, the time difference shifts based on the time of year.
- During Standard Time (typically November to March): The time difference is 16 hours. When it's noon in LA, it's 4:00 AM the following day in the Philippines.
- During Daylight Saving Time (typically March to November): The time difference is 15 hours. When it's noon in LA, it's 3:00 AM the following day in the Philippines.
See? It's all about those shifts! This means if you're calling someone or planning an event, you need to check the current date and time in both locations to avoid any scheduling mishaps. Traveling Between LA and the Philippines: What You Need to Know
Planning a trip between Los Angeles and the Philippines? Awesome! But before you book your flights and pack your bags, there are some essential things you should know. Besides the Los Angeles Philippines time difference, consider these factors:
- Flight Duration: Flights can be long, often taking around 14-16 hours, depending on layovers. Be prepared for a significant amount of time in transit. That means you should have books, podcasts, or movies to keep yourself entertained. Remember, the journey is just as important as the destination!
- Jet Lag: Get ready for jet lag, especially if you're traveling from LA to the Philippines. You're essentially moving your body clock ahead by 15 or 16 hours! To minimize the effects, start adjusting your sleep schedule a few days before your trip. Stay hydrated, avoid excessive caffeine and alcohol, and try to get some sunlight when you arrive. Consider your travel time when packing to have comfortable clothing and accessories available. It is important to stay hydrated and rest up, as this will help you to enjoy your trip without feeling completely drained.
- Packing Essentials: Pack for both warm and potentially rainy weather. The Philippines has a tropical climate. Bring comfortable walking shoes, sunscreen, insect repellent, and any necessary medications. Don't forget an adapter if your electronics use different plugs.
- Currency and Finances: The currency in the Philippines is the Philippine Peso (PHP). It's a good idea to exchange some currency before you arrive or withdraw money from ATMs upon arrival. Make sure you inform your bank about your travel plans to avoid any issues with your cards. Plan your expenses and consider using credit cards for convenience.
